As a Consultant Support Associate, you will play a critical role in optimizing the efficiency of the team by handling administrative, operational, and client service tasks. This role allows consultants to focus on client relationships and financial advice while ensuring that processes run smoothly and efficiently.

By managing client documentation, follow-ups, and operational workflows, the Consultant Support Associate enhances the client experience, improves team productivity, and supports business growth.

This position requires str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a proactive mindset to support consultants in delivering a high-quality, personalized service to plan participants.

What you’ll accomplish with us
As a Consultant Support Associate, you’ll be at the core of our mission. Here are the main responsibilities:

Administrative Support to Consultants

  • Prepare and organize client‑facing documentation, reports, and meeting materials for consultants.
  • Provide support with account openings, asset transfers, investment changes, and beneficiary updates.
  • Ensure timely follow‑up on action items after meetings, including follow‑ups with participants.
  • Maintain accurate and up‑to‑date client records in customer relationship management (CRM) and financial planning systems.
  • Handle complex or special cases and ensure follow‑up within established deadlines, within the scope of your role.
  • Process participant requests in administrative systems.
  • Respond to participant inquiries and provide information based on requests from advisors.

Client Interaction and Service Support

  • Act as a point of contact for participant requests by responding to routine inquiries (e.g., document requests, contribution updates, etc.).
  • Pre‑fill various forms and send them to participants. (You will also assist with quality control and the distribution of contract registration documents prepared by consultants.)
  • Communicate with participants using pre‑approved email templates.
  • Support consultants in their personalized outreach efforts by ensuring timely communication with participants.

Operational Efficiency and Process Improvement

  • Work closely with internal teams (e.g., Compliance and Operations) to ensure the smooth execution of financial transactions.
  • Identify opportunities to streamline workflows and improve service delivery efficiency.
  • Participate in tracking and reporting on consultant performance by ensuring the accuracy of client engagement documentation.
  • Manage special projects for the team.
  • Actively participate in weekly team meetings and propose improvement ideas.

Compliance and Regulatory Support

  • Ensure that all client‑facing documentation complies with regulatory and compliance requirements.
  • Support consultants in applying best practices related to data privacy and security when handling participants’ personal information.
  • Support internal audits and compliance teams’ documentation requests.

What could accelerate your success in this role
We’re looking for someone who:

  • Is known for their strong organizational and administrative sk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ities efficiently and rigorously.
  • Stands out for their collaborative mindset, team spirit, and ease in building professional relationships with consultants, clients, and internal partners.
  • Demonstrates strong communication and customer service skills, supported by experience in administrative and client support roles.
  • Is recognized for their attention to detail and accuracy when managing client records, documentation, and financial or administrative transactions.
  • Has 2+ years of experience in financial services, client service, or administrative support roles; experience with group retirement plans, wealth management, insurance, or Salesforce is considered an asset.
  • Advanced level of English and French proficiency, as the role involves written and verbal communications with consultants, internal teams, and clients across Canada on a regular basis in both languages.

The typical hiring range for this position is between $47 544 and $68 329 CAD per year; the base salary offered may vary depending on knowledge, skills, years of experience, and internal equity related to the role. At iA, we are committed to offering a fair, equitable, and market-based compensation structure. Our market data is updated annually to reflect the most current market conditions.

iA Financial Group* is the strength of a company with a human side, with its over 8,000 employees. Together, we have earned the trust of our more than four million clients and 25,000 advisors who have chosen us for their insurance, savings, and wealth management.

With over $200 billion in assets and half a billion invested in technological innovation, we’re a key player in the financial services industry in Canada and the United States. What you need to know about the Toronto Tech Scene

Although home to some of the biggest names in tech, including Google, Microsoft and Amazon, Toronto has established itself as one of the largest startup ecosystems in the world. And with over 2,000 startups — more than 30 percent of the country's total startups — Toronto continues to attract new businesses. Be it helping entrepreneurs manage their finances, simplifying business operations by automating payroll or assisting pharmaceutical companies in launching new drugs, the city's tech scene is just getting started.
